.kad-shop-top { margin: 0px 0 20px; } .woocommerce-result-count { margin: 0; font-size: 12px; line-height: 30px; } .woocommerce-ordering { margin: 0; float: right; text-align: left; position: relative; width: auto; height: 30px; margin-bottom: 0px; } .woocommerce-ordering .select2-container .select2-choice { height: 30px; line-height: 30px; } .woocommerce-ordering .select2-container .select2-choice > .select2-chosen { line-height: 28px; } .woocommerce-ordering .select2-container .select2-choice .select2-arrow b:after { line-height: 30px; } .woocommerce-ordering select, div.product form.cart .variations td.product_value select{ opacity: 0; } .customSelect { padding: 0; border-radius: 6px; border: 2px solid #eee; border-color: rgba(0,0,0,0.05); background: 0; text-align: left; overflow: hidden; display: block; height: 30px; text-transform: uppercase; line-height: 28px; font-weight: bold; transition: background .6s ease-out; -webkit-transition: background .6s ease-out; -moz-transition: background .6s ease-out; -o-transition: background .6s ease-out; } .customSelect.customSelectHover { background: #f2f2f2; background: rgba(0,0,0,0.01); } .customSelect .customSelectInner:after{ font-family: FontAwesome; speak: none; font-style: normal; font-weight: normal; font-variant: normal; text-transform: none; -webkit-font-smoothing: antialiased; content: "\f107"; font-size: 12px; margin-right: 10px; text-align: right; height: 30px; float: right; line-height: 28px; } .customSelectInner { margin-left: 10px; font-size: 14px; } a.added_to_cart { display: block; position: absolute; top: 50%; right: 0; text-align: center; margin-right: 0; margin-top: -30px; width: 100%; height: 60px; background: #fff; background: rgba(255,255,255,0.65); line-height: 60px; font-size: 14px; font-weight: 800; z-index: 100; -webkit-transition: background 0.2s ease-in-out; -moz-transition: background 0.2s ease-in-out; -ms-transition: background 0.2s ease-in-out; -o-transition: background 0.2s ease-in-out; transition: background 0.2s ease-in-out; } a.added_to_cart:hover { background: @primary; color:#fff; } .product_details .product_excerpt { display: none; } a.kad-btn.loading:before { content: ""; position: absolute; top: 0; right: 0; left: 0; bottom: 0; background: url(../img/ajax-loader.gif) center no-repeat rgba(255, 255, 255, 0.65); } .woocommerce .products .star-rating { display: block; margin:3px auto 3px; float: none; } .products div.product_item { position: relative; border-radius: 5px; -webkit-border-radius: 5px; -moz-border-radius: 5px; box-shadow: 0 -3px rgba(0, 0, 0, 0.1) inset; -moz-box-shadow: 0 -3px rgba(0, 0, 0, 0.1) inset; -webkit-box-shadow: 0 -3px rgba(0, 0, 0, 0.1) inset; -o-box-shadow: 0 -3px rgba(0, 0, 0, 0.1) inset; } .product_item a.product_img_link { padding: 10px 10px 0; } .woocommerce ul.cart_list li img { float: right; margin-left: 4px; margin-top: 5px; width: 50px; height: auto; } // Woo Page nav nav.woocommerce-pagination { text-align: center; margin-bottom: 20px; } nav.woocommerce-pagination ul { display: inline-block; white-space: nowrap; padding: 0; clear: both; margin:0; } nav.woocommerce-pagination ul li { padding: 0; float: left; margin: 0; display: inline; overflow: hidden; } nav.woocommerce-pagination ul li a, nav.woocommerce-pagination ul li span { padding:6px 12px; font-size:12px; font-weight:bold; margin:5px; display: inline-block; border: 0; color:#444; -webkit-border-radius: 4px; -moz-border-radius: 4px; border-radius: 4px; background: #f9f9f9; background: rgba(0, 0, 0, 0.05); -webkit-transition: background 0.4s ease-in-out; -moz-transition: background 0.4s ease-in-out; -ms-transition: background 0.4s ease-in-out; -o-transition: background 0.4s ease-in-out; transition: background 0.4s ease-in-out; } nav.woocommerce-pagination ul li a:hover { background:@primary; color:#fff; } nav.woocommerce-pagination ul li span.current { background:@primary; color:#fff; } .cat_main_img { text-align: center; } .term-description { padding: 10px 0; font-size: 14px; } //Rating .products .star-rating { display: block; margin: 3px auto 4px; float: none; } .star-rating span { overflow: hidden; float: left; top: 0; left: 0; position: absolute; padding-top: 1.5em; } .star-rating:before { content: "\73\73\73\73\73"; color: #dfdbdf; float: left; top: 0; left: 0; position: absolute; } .star-rating span:before { content: "\53\53\53\53\53"; top: 0; position: absolute; left: 0; } .star-rating { float: right; overflow: hidden; position: relative; height: 1em; line-height: 1em; font-size: 1em; width: 5.4em; font-family: 'star'; } .shopcolumn1 .product_item a.product_item_link img, .shopcolumn2.shopfullwidth .product_item a.product_item_link img { float: left; margin-right: 20px; } .shopcolumn1 .product_item .product_details, .shopcolumn2.shopfullwidth .product_item .product_details { text-align: left; padding: 0 10px; } .shopcolumn1 .product_item, .shopcolumn2.shopfullwidth .product_item { text-align: left; } .shopcolumn1 .product_item .product_details .product_excerpt { display: block; margin-left: 280px; } .shopcolumn1 .product_item .price { margin-left: 280px; } .shopcolumn2.shopfullwidth .product_item .product_details .product_excerpt { margin-left: 240px; } .shopcolumn2 .product_item .product_details .product_excerpt { display: block; } .shopcolumn2.shopfullwidth .product_item a.product_item_link img { max-width: 230px; } .shopcolumn2.shopfullwidth .product_item .kad_add_to_cart, .shopcolumn2.shopfullwidth .product_item .product_price { margin-left: 250px; } .shopcolumn1 .product_item .kad_add_to_cart { display: inline-block; margin-top: 10px; padding: 8px 18px; font-size: 18px; } .shopcolumn2.shopfullwidth .product_item .kad_add_to_cart { display: block; text-align: center; margin-top: 10px; padding: 8px 18px; font-size: 18px; } .products.shopcolumn1 .product_item ul, .products.shopcolumn2.shopfullwidth .product_item ul { clear: none; margin: 0 0 10px; display: inline-block; } .woocommerce .products.shopcolumn1 .product_item .star-rating, .woocommerce .products.shopcolumn2.shopfullwidth .product_item .star-rating { display: inline-block; } .kt-cat-intrinsic img { position: absolute; left: 0; top: 0; width: 100%; height: 100%; } .kt-cat-intrinsic { position: relative; height: 0; }